Trademark Registration in Tamil Nadu

Registering a trademark in Tamil Nadu involves a systematic process that begins with filing an application with the appropriate authorities. The first step is to conduct a thorough search to ensure that your desired trademark is unique and not already in use by another entity. This is crucial to avoid potential conflicts and legal issues down the line.

Once the search is completed and the uniqueness of your trademark is confirmed, you can proceed with filing an application with the Trademarks Registry. The application must include details such as the name and address of the applicant, a clear representation of the trademark, and the class or classes in which you wish to register the trademark.

After the application is submitted, it will undergo examination by the Trademarks Registry to ensure that it complies with all legal requirements. If there are no objections or oppositions raised during the examination process, your trademark will be registered, and you will receive a certificate of registration.

Trademark Renewal in Tamil Nadu

Once your trademark is registered, it is essential to renew it periodically to maintain legal protection. In Tamil Nadu, trademarks are typically renewed every ten years. Failure to renew your trademark on time can result in its expiration and loss of legal rights over the mark.

To renew your trademark in Tamil Nadu, you must file a renewal application with the Trademarks Registry before the expiry date. The renewal application must include the details of the trademark, such as the registration number and class, along with the prescribed renewal fee.

It is advisable to keep track of the renewal dates for your trademark to ensure timely renewal and continued protection of your brand identity.

Trademark Transfer in Tamil Nadu

In some cases, you may wish to transfer your trademark to another party. This could be due to a change in ownership or a business transaction that involves the transfer of intellectual property rights. In Tamil Nadu, the process of transferring a trademark requires formal documentation and approval from the Trademarks Registry.

When transferring a trademark in Tamil Nadu, both parties must enter into a legally binding agreement that outlines the terms of the transfer. This agreement must be submitted to the Trademarks Registry along with the necessary forms and fees for processing the transfer.

It is important to follow the proper procedures and obtain consent from the original owner when transferring a trademark to ensure that the transfer is legally valid and recognized by the authorities.

Trademark Search in Tamil Nadu

Before applying for trademark registration in Tamil Nadu, it is essential to conduct a comprehensive search to ensure that your desired trademark is available for registration. A trademark search helps identify any existing trademarks that are similar to yours and could potentially lead to conflicts or objections during the registration process.

You can conduct a trademark search in Tamil Nadu through online databases or by hiring a professional trademark attorney to assist you. The search should cover not only identical trademarks but also variations that might be considered confusingly similar.

By conducting a thorough trademark search, you can avoid potential legal disputes and ensure a smooth registration process for your trademark in Tamil Nadu.

Design Registration in Tamil Nadu

Design registration is essential for protecting the visual appearance of your products in Tamil Nadu. By registering a design, you can prevent others from copying or imitating the unique features and aesthetics of your products, giving you a competitive edge in the market.

To register a design in Tamil Nadu, you must file an application with the Designs Registry, providing detailed drawings or representations of the design. The application will undergo examination to ensure that it meets the legal requirements for registration.

Design registration in Tamil Nadu provides you with exclusive rights over the visual aspects of your products, helping you differentiate your offerings from competitors and build a strong brand identity.

Patent Registration in Tamil Nadu

For inventors and innovators in Tamil Nadu, patent registration is essential for protecting their inventions and technological innovations. A patent grants you exclusive rights over your invention, preventing others from making, using, or selling it without your permission.

To register a patent in Tamil Nadu, you must file a patent application with the Patent Office, disclosing the details of your invention and its unique features. The patent application will undergo examination to assess its novelty, inventive step, and industrial applicability.

Patent registration in Tamil Nadu provides you with a legal framework to commercialize your invention and generate revenue from licensing agreements or partnerships. It also encourages innovation and promotes technological progress in the region.
